The Age of Your Roof
When you talk to a qualified residential roofing contractor in Mattoon, IL,
they will tell you that a shingle roof is not meant to last forever. In fact,
the average lifespan is 20 to 25 years. If your roof is at least 20 years old,
you want to have it inspected to see if any issues are starting to arise so
that you can catch them early.
Buckling and Curling
Shingles
You can usually just look up at your roof to see if this is a
problem. When this happens, moisture is able to get to your subroofing. As
moisture collects, mold and mildew can start to form. At this point, you might
have to replace the subroofing and the shingles to ensure that everything is
done correctly. To avoid the mold and mildew, as soon as you notice bucking and
curling, you want to have a professional roof evaluation.
There Are Missing Shingles
Once shingles start to go missing, there is nothing there to protect
the wooden subroofing. So, over time, you will start to notice leaks coming
into your home. Not only is there a risk for mold and mildew, but this can also
cause damage to your walls and floors. If water falls onto your belongings,
they too can become damaged.
You Can See Daylight
Go up to the highest level of your home and look up. If you see
daylight streaming in, your roof needs to be replaced because the shingles and
roof boards are no longer sufficient. Remember that if the sunlight can come
in, so can weather and critters.
